How can you govern a country which has 246 varieties of cheese?
Interpretation
This quote humorously suggests that governing a diverse and complex society is challenging.
Charles De Gaulle's quote playfully highlights the complexities and absurdities that come with governing a nation rich in diversity, using the metaphor of having 246 varieties of cheese to symbolize the multifaceted nature of society. It underscores the idea that a leader must navigate through various tastes, preferences, and cultural intricacies, making governance a daunting task.
